#18bef6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#18bef6 is composed of 9.4% red, 74.5%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 195.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#18bef6 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#007ded.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

Shades and Tints of #18bef6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b0e is the darkest color, while #fbf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#18bef6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878787 is the less saturated color, while #18bef6 is the most saturated one.
